Key Responsibilities

  • •Drive and execute development and design of specialized RF sensor hardware, technical data packages, and performance requirements.
  • •Collaborate with interdisciplinary engineering teams (thermal, structural, mechanical, systems) to ensure design compliance.
  • •Analyze simulation and test data to verify performance against requirements.
  • •Create and ensure review of documentation including analyses, schematics, interface drawings, test plans, and specifications.
  • •Serve as a subject matter expert with RF sensor manufacturing suppliers and perform non-advocate design reviews across the company.

Key Requirements

  • •Typically requires a Bachelor’s in STEM with at least 8 years of relevant experience, or an Advanced Degree with at least 6 years of relevant experience.
  • •Experience with antenna design, including concept trades/studies, preliminary and final design, and/or qualification processes.
  • •Experience with simulation and modeling using tools such as HFSS, CST, FEKO, SENTRi, PMM, and/or GRASP.
  • •Experience evaluating RF sensor measurements and post-processed data.
  • •Ability to obtain an INTERIM U.S. government issued security clearance prior to start (with ability to obtain special program access after start).
